Oh how fun. A new area to organize and create from. Since it will be so large, can I assume you won't be moving it around much? It reminds me of our old cutting tables at work. Trouble was it left alot of "dead" space underneath. I like to have everything within reach, no matter how impossible that sounds.

So, if your needs dictate, how about some sort of shelving underneath to hold your books, magazines, patterns, misc. papers, fabric storage, which could be hidden behind cabinet doors that run the length of table, however deep you make them, and however you might position them on the other side. Or maybe on one end put drawers to hold scissors, pins, rotary cutters, blades, just any notions that you have.

I bought this really neat pattern to make a thread holder from fabric to hang on the wall. At one point I was using the June Taylor wood spool racks, but they took up too much table space. I have a plastic fold out carrier I got from JoAnn's that works nicely but I loved the idea of displaying it in a wall hanger as I have the wall space to utilize.
